In our program we have an entrance HESI and a HESI at the end of 2nd and third semester. Then we have an exit HESI at the end of fourth semester. The only one that we are required to pass is the exit HESI. If you fail one before that you have to do "remediation" which translates to case studies on the specific material you missed. These tests are in addition to our other class tests. They add 60.00 to every semester when we register to pay for "testing fees".
